Bio Notes: Douglas Pairman Hall, who was born in Scotland but emigrated to New York in 1912, practised in partnership with ____ Riley towards the end of his career. He was a theatre specialist and designed some fifty theatres and cinemas in the New York area. He died on 5 July 1945.
